1641 isnt the best on a van. Its a bored out 1600, so thinner barrell walls, which may get hot in a heavy van.

Machining for the 1776 etc isnt that dear .... with balancing, you should get change from £100, and that gives you the opportunity the throw a slightly cheeky cam into the equation. Twin carbs will give you a good performance boost for the money, and get a decent merged header system, too.
